Many things can cause iron stains on the vinyl siding of a home. The best way to remove these stains is to use tub and tile cleaner and a cloth scouring pad.
You can stain T 111 siding with an oil or water based solid stain. You can also use a semi-transparent stain, however, it may have a blotchy or nonuniform appearance.

There are many options when it comes to siding your house. You can go with wood clapboard siding, which you can choose to either stain, paint or leave bare. Cedar shingle siding is a type of wood siding that's popular in New England. You can go with stucco siding if you want to add a dash of old-world elegance to your home. You can choose vinyl siding if you want an affordable, low-maintenance option. Aluminum is also a choice for people who want a clean, contemporary appearance. Finally, fiber cement siding is a useful wood substitute, as it looks like wood but is far more durable when it comes to keeping out bugs, fire and mold.
